Jake’s 58 offers rewards for veterans and first responders

Jake’s 58 Casino and Hotel is offering a new reward for its Players Club members called the Hero Card.

Suffolk OTB, which owns and operates the Islandia casino, created the card as a ‘thank you’ to veterans, active-duty military, first responders and hospital workers. Hero Card benefits include top-tier card rewards of 25 percent discounts on the hotel and restaurants and free valet parking.

“These men and women risk their lives to keep us safe, and we want to give them nothing but the best treatment and highest rewards, from the moment they walk in the door to the moment they leave,” Suffolk OTB Vice President and COO Anthony Pancella said in a written statement.

The Hero Card is just one more way for Suffolk OTB to give back to the community. Suffolk OTB recently began a program to assist local charities by allowing patrons the option to “round down” to assist local charities.

The ATM machines at Jake’s 58 now allow patrons the option to give a portion of cashed-in tickets to charity. Its first charity partners are EAC Network, Island Harvest and Long Island Cares.
